Human vision is limited to wavelengths ranging from __ nm to __ nm.

A. 4 to 70
B. 40 to 700
C. 400 to 700
D. 400 to 7000
E. 4000 to 7000

Answer :

Final answer:

The correct option is C. 400 to 700. The wavelengths of light that the human eye can perceive, known as the visible spectrum, range from 400 nm to 700 nm.

Explanation:

The correct option is C. 400 to 700. Human vision is limited to wavelengths ranging from about 400 nm to 700 nm. This range corresponds to the part of the electromagnetic spectrum known as the visible spectrum. Wavelengths shorter than 400 nm fall into the ultraviolet range, while wavelengths longer than 700 nm are in the infrared range. The visible spectrum encompasses all the colors that the human eye can perceive, with shorter wavelengths appearing violet and longer wavelengths appearing red.
